model.js 376 B

123456789101112131415161718192021222324
  1. import { getElementId, randomCode, deepCopy } from "../../plugins/utils";
  2. const MODEL = {
  3. type: "PANE",
  4. x: 0,
  5. y: 0,
  6. w: 200,
  7. h: 200,
  8. sign: "",
  9. bold: "1px",
  10. color: "#000000",
  11. bgColor: "#ffffff",
  12. style: "solid"
  13. };
  14. const getModel = () => {
  15. return {
  16. id: getElementId(),
  17. key: randomCode(),
  18. ...deepCopy(MODEL)
  19. };
  20. };
  21. export { MODEL, getModel };